Pre- and post-production — Emissions Share (CO2eq) (AR5) in Southern Asia
Southern Asia: Pre- and post-production — Emissions Share (CO2eq) (AR5) was 47.45 % in 2023. ▼ Falling
Pre- and post-production — Emissions Share (CO2eq) (AR5) in Southern Asia,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in %.
Analysis
In 2023, pre- and post-production — emissions share (co2eq) (ar5) in Southern Asia stood at 47.45 %.
Compared with earlier readings it is down 5.3% on the previous year and down 13.5% over ten years.
Over the whole period, pre- and post-production — emissions share (co2eq) (ar5) in Southern Asia peaked at 92.08 % in 1992 and was at its lowest, 9.88 %, in 1996.
Southern Asia ranks 14th of 31 groups on this measure, in the middle of the range.
The long-run direction has been consistently falling across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
